Emma Frost - She is formerly known as the White Queen and is a mutant telepath known for her revealing white attire, Frost has been both friend and foe of the X-Men. She was originally one of the wealthy, mutant elites who composed the Inner Circle of the Hellfire Club. She has had a lifelong interest in teaching the next generation and led the club’s junior team the Hellions. After her students’ deaths, she joined Charles Xavier’s cause, mentoring the X-Men junior team Generation X. She later joined the X-Men and became headmistress of the Xavier Institute, although her ethics remain questionable. during her current role she has had an affair with Cyclops. As well as her telepathic abilities she also can change into an indestructible diamond form which gives her superhuman strength. vs The Comedian - Edward Blake is a superhero featured in the DC Comics series Watchmen. Only seen in flashback as it starts with his murder the Comedian is a rough gruff type of hero. A cigar-chomping, gun-toting vigilante-turned-paramilitary agent. During some of the series' most intense moments, he has shown himself to be a nihilist with little regard for morality or human life. It may even be possible that, because no motivation is ever stated, he only fights crime as an excuse to please a sadistic desire to commit violent acts. Originally she is an inhabitant of the planet Drakulon, a world where people lived on blood and where blood flowed in rivers. This planet died and she escaped to Earth to continue her race, but at the same time rid the world of out 'bad' vampires. she needs blood to survive and has many of the typical vampiric powers, including increased strength and reflexes, shapeshifting into a bat, and a mesmeric stare. She is not prone to the group's traditional weaknesses, such as daylight, holy water, garlic, or crosses. She cannot, most importantly, transform others into vampires. She does not attack people to drink their blood, except occasionally when she herself is attacked. vs Ultron - An android supervillain in the Marvel Comics universe. Ultron believes in the superiority of mechanical entities over humans and organic life in general, and has often endeavored to either exterminate those "lesser" beings or convert them into mechanical forms. With few exceptions, Ultron's independent plans have predominately brought him into conflict with the Avengers, sometimes out of a deliberate desire of his to confront them where other villains would prefer to avoid such a fight. Ultron has many different links to the Avengers; most prominently, he regards Hank Pym and Janet van Dyne, founding members of the team, as his 'parents', and has developed an Oedipus Complex in his relationship with them, attempting to kill Hank and once using Janet's brain patterns to try and create a bride for himself. Having created the Vision, he sees the android as his 'son'. Ultron's abilities vary with each redesign, but typically include superhuman strength and durability, the power of flight, and various offensive weapons such as concussion blasters, radiation emitters and his "encephalo-ray", which plunges its victims into a deathlike coma. Ultron's outer shell is usually composed of Adamantium, rendering it almost totally impervious to damage; even a punch from the Hulk only caused a slight dent.
